Data Privacy Definition
Data Privacy, in the context of blockchain and cryptocurrencies, refers to the measures and protocols implemented to ensure the protection and confidentiality of personal and transactional data that is stored, processed, or transmitted through blockchain networks. It revolves around the rights and control an individual has over their personal data and how that data is collected, used, and disseminated.
What is Data Privacy?
Data privacy is about respecting individuals’ rights and freedoms when processing their personal data. It includes principles and guidelines that dictate how data should be managed, including consent, notice, regulatory obligations, data security, data quality and integrity, access and participation, and accountability.
In blockchain and cryptocurrencies, data privacy is particularly important due to the nature of these technologies. Blockchains are decentralized and often transparent, meaning that transactions are public and can be viewed by anyone.

Why is Data Privacy Important?
Data privacy is vital because it protects individuals’ rights and freedoms in relation to their personal data. In the blockchain and cryptocurrency sphere, it’s particularly important due to the decentralized and often transparent nature of these technologies.
Inadequate data privacy can expose users to risks such as identity theft, fraud, financial loss, and violation of privacy rights. For businesses and other organizations, failing to ensure data privacy can result in legal penalties, reputational damage, and loss of user trust.
How is Data Privacy Ensured in Blockchain and Cryptocurrencies?
Data privacy in blockchain and cryptocurrencies is ensured through a combination of technology and regulatory measures. On the technical side, privacy-enhancing technologies such as zero-knowledge proofs, ring signatures, and privacy-focused cryptocurrencies can provide privacy protection.
On the regulatory side, data privacy laws and guidelines provide a framework for how personal data should be handled. Compliance with these regulations is essential for any organization involved in the blockchain and cryptocurrency industry.
